Skip to main content

Python<->ObjC Interoperability Module

Project description

PyObjC is a bridge between Python and Objective-C. It allows full featured Cocoa applications to be written in pure Python. It is also easy to use other frameworks containing Objective-C class libraries from Python and to mix in Objective-C, C and C++ source.

Python is a highly dynamic programming language with a shallow learning curve. It combines remarkable power with very clear syntax.

PyObjC also supports full introspection of Objective-C classes and direct invocation of Objective-C APIs from the interactive interpreter.

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pyobjc-core-5.2.tar.gz (797.9 kB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

pyobjc_core-5.2-cp37-cp37m-macosx_10_9_x86_64.whl (294.5 kB view details)

Uploaded CPython 3.7mmacOS 10.9+ x86-64

pyobjc_core-5.2-cp37-cp37m-macosx_10_6_intel.whl (533.7 kB view details)

Uploaded CPython 3.7mmacOS 10.6+ Intel (x86-64, i386)

pyobjc_core-5.2-cp36-cp36m-macosx_10_9_x86_64.whl (294.5 kB view details)

Uploaded CPython 3.6mmacOS 10.9+ x86-64

pyobjc_core-5.2-cp36-cp36m-macosx_10_6_intel.whl (533.6 kB view details)

Uploaded CPython 3.6mmacOS 10.6+ Intel (x86-64, i386)

pyobjc_core-5.2-cp35-cp35m-macosx_10_6_intel.whl (533.6 kB view details)

Uploaded CPython 3.5mmacOS 10.6+ Intel (x86-64, i386)

pyobjc_core-5.2-cp34-cp34m-macosx_10_6_intel.whl (533.5 kB view details)

Uploaded CPython 3.4mmacOS 10.6+ Intel (x86-64, i386)

pyobjc_core-5.2-cp27-cp27m-macosx_10_9_x86_64.whl (298.0 kB view details)

Uploaded CPython 2.7mmacOS 10.9+ x86-64

pyobjc_core-5.2-cp27-cp27m-macosx_10_6_intel.whl (542.0 kB view details)

Uploaded CPython 2.7mmacOS 10.6+ Intel (x86-64, i386)

File details

Details for the file pyobjc-core-5.2.tar.gz.

File metadata

  • Download URL: pyobjc-core-5.2.tar.gz
  • Upload date:
  • Size: 797.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.7.3

File hashes

Hashes for pyobjc-core-5.2.tar.gz
Algorithm Hash digest
SHA256 cd13a2e9be890064a6dd11db7790bbf38502350c532a9a9d05511abb8683b8ea
MD5 bf0bc90253536f2ce57b035b2d435aed
BLAKE2b-256 d3f507579f2986f2eb639932626f69a082598f5e6d4535e1f54a331d9efa97d7

See more details on using hashes here.

File details

Details for the file pyobjc_core-5.2-cp37-cp37m-macosx_10_9_x86_64.whl.

File metadata

  • Download URL: pyobjc_core-5.2-cp37-cp37m-macosx_10_9_x86_64.whl
  • Upload date:
  • Size: 294.5 kB
  • Tags: CPython 3.7m, macOS 10.9+ x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.7.3

File hashes

Hashes for pyobjc_core-5.2-cp37-cp37m-macosx_10_9_x86_64.whl
Algorithm Hash digest
SHA256 046449f510c1f33d41bdd0d4c8eb2f084593a2ee4573a25d604bdccabb7a909e
MD5 faabcd3b98763d6486f2e8c36fc335a9
BLAKE2b-256 c8bacb2f5b8a6c78de08b89f7f90cddbde3b10a8392b8350c0a0cf92120c5f43

See more details on using hashes here.

File details

Details for the file pyobjc_core-5.2-cp37-cp37m-macosx_10_6_intel.whl.

File metadata

  • Download URL: pyobjc_core-5.2-cp37-cp37m-macosx_10_6_intel.whl
  • Upload date:
  • Size: 533.7 kB
  • Tags: CPython 3.7m, macOS 10.6+ Intel (x86-64, i386)
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.7.3

File hashes

Hashes for pyobjc_core-5.2-cp37-cp37m-macosx_10_6_intel.whl
Algorithm Hash digest
SHA256 66651923eb225d3ad2a07c0b3530842c06b8f35e5adf30c74ea378697691bb09
MD5 ba9a19d929d33c5c00c846c4f43a36ea
BLAKE2b-256 bd070aee892871f53a4217f787aebcab21cc01d76a730163e9e695bbc37ded1a

See more details on using hashes here.

File details

Details for the file pyobjc_core-5.2-cp36-cp36m-macosx_10_9_x86_64.whl.

File metadata

  • Download URL: pyobjc_core-5.2-cp36-cp36m-macosx_10_9_x86_64.whl
  • Upload date:
  • Size: 294.5 kB
  • Tags: CPython 3.6m, macOS 10.9+ x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.7.3

File hashes

Hashes for pyobjc_core-5.2-cp36-cp36m-macosx_10_9_x86_64.whl
Algorithm Hash digest
SHA256 5ae84984fa4967a6b6962ae25997de954d110efeea69ff1f09e128675f86dc80
MD5 ae3346ec095deac9197d5160c4ae594a
BLAKE2b-256 3c82c380c61edb13a46b3da3510eabf95a44c8653b967253a09129c9f284b1e9

See more details on using hashes here.

File details

Details for the file pyobjc_core-5.2-cp36-cp36m-macosx_10_6_intel.whl.

File metadata

  • Download URL: pyobjc_core-5.2-cp36-cp36m-macosx_10_6_intel.whl
  • Upload date:
  • Size: 533.6 kB
  • Tags: CPython 3.6m, macOS 10.6+ Intel (x86-64, i386)
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.7.3

File hashes

Hashes for pyobjc_core-5.2-cp36-cp36m-macosx_10_6_intel.whl
Algorithm Hash digest
SHA256 b551af26c21883a6e27c0ce58e5e9f3ae9027388686ae978d134afa102164045
MD5 cafa76cb15509a0a49853fe4a6dcb64f
BLAKE2b-256 b98105ab44dfeca960851c56f8bc62427dd0dc04b72c3d2f8b87eb90653d5b1e

See more details on using hashes here.

File details

Details for the file pyobjc_core-5.2-cp35-cp35m-macosx_10_6_intel.whl.

File metadata

  • Download URL: pyobjc_core-5.2-cp35-cp35m-macosx_10_6_intel.whl
  • Upload date:
  • Size: 533.6 kB
  • Tags: CPython 3.5m, macOS 10.6+ Intel (x86-64, i386)
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.7.3

File hashes

Hashes for pyobjc_core-5.2-cp35-cp35m-macosx_10_6_intel.whl
Algorithm Hash digest
SHA256 9c79ab63ec48f195a5c07bbb7bc73378b6a45b1d7893f911ff51c918dae13538
MD5 c792368b307021d322d62f359085082b
BLAKE2b-256 6c0d89103b8f1838392a20776772c6cfa8e1296034c357fdb03caf52f96f85a5

See more details on using hashes here.

File details

Details for the file pyobjc_core-5.2-cp34-cp34m-macosx_10_6_intel.whl.

File metadata

  • Download URL: pyobjc_core-5.2-cp34-cp34m-macosx_10_6_intel.whl
  • Upload date:
  • Size: 533.5 kB
  • Tags: CPython 3.4m, macOS 10.6+ Intel (x86-64, i386)
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.7.3

File hashes

Hashes for pyobjc_core-5.2-cp34-cp34m-macosx_10_6_intel.whl
Algorithm Hash digest
SHA256 6f3dd8e20119d5c75ea5ac548734fef2702c457b66aa66059b6e037129467f95
MD5 7f2aa29f765c58cf96ad85080f670750
BLAKE2b-256 604597461b279205fdfa3206285955aaf40836dd8cbeb104330f6ce657be4b75

See more details on using hashes here.

File details

Details for the file pyobjc_core-5.2-cp27-cp27m-macosx_10_9_x86_64.whl.

File metadata

  • Download URL: pyobjc_core-5.2-cp27-cp27m-macosx_10_9_x86_64.whl
  • Upload date:
  • Size: 298.0 kB
  • Tags: CPython 2.7m, macOS 10.9+ x86-64
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.7.3

File hashes

Hashes for pyobjc_core-5.2-cp27-cp27m-macosx_10_9_x86_64.whl
Algorithm Hash digest
SHA256 a6f65fb313e5e1efab5c4b4591142a73af4ca52a2c39d98f540f42fc774e262e
MD5 332d9bd856aa9a3545392c164e3a508a
BLAKE2b-256 7336403769823a696dd8a02b5b3f74ccfa603be8575f2d5b70ba8eba73af7375

See more details on using hashes here.

File details

Details for the file pyobjc_core-5.2-cp27-cp27m-macosx_10_6_intel.whl.

File metadata

  • Download URL: pyobjc_core-5.2-cp27-cp27m-macosx_10_6_intel.whl
  • Upload date:
  • Size: 542.0 kB
  • Tags: CPython 2.7m, macOS 10.6+ Intel (x86-64, i386)
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.8.0 tqdm/4.29.1 CPython/3.7.3

File hashes

Hashes for pyobjc_core-5.2-cp27-cp27m-macosx_10_6_intel.whl
Algorithm Hash digest
SHA256 6be4631868b36dde9a771707f325b7ea7616f5ca1ad38eafe8435f4757193419
MD5 8efa0096ae146f978b843cbe975bea5c
BLAKE2b-256 f56fd4f42901edaa0d62bcf954d4ebae245584d1eb7b49f1935b0b0fd43b7bc7

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page